Your search bar should be somewhere around the top of your page layout and should have the capacity to hold 27 visible characters. The button that puts the search query into the system should be labeled “search”, rather than “submit” or “okay.” The term ‘search’ will help people notice the search box and encourage them to use it.

Always avoid captchas unless you are using them for user registration. As soon as a viewer sees a captcha, they will automatically think that they will have to do to much work just too see your webpage. All but a site’s biggest fans will leave if they have to fill out too many CAPTCHAs.

Hiring a friend or family member to design your website can often be a mistake. You can’t fire family, it’s a fact, so if they design something you don’t want you’ll end up disappointed or they’ll leave frustrated.
Remember, designing your site needs not to cost a lot of money. You can find cheap or free website design tools that do the same things as expensive website design software. For example, open source software that is free can assist you in accomplishing tasks that are exactly the same as paid software. You can realize significant savings by seeking out such open source alternatives for your software needs.
Create an opt-in newsletter to entice your visitors to return often. Letting customers subscribe to updates and new information can keep them coming back. You can incorporate a form in the sidebar of the site and track users that sign up. Make sure you only send out the letter to those that have explicitly requested to view it.
Make sure to include a search function. If you do this, visitors will perceive that your site is more user-friendly; it becomes instantly easier to locate the targeted information. These searches are easy to add — and worth the time.
Your content should be globally user-friendly. Ensure that you provide measurements, dates, times and currency figures in terms that can be understood by a world-wide audience. Your visitors will come from different geographical regions, so you should design your content that will be appealing to your visitors around the world.
